Location & Description

The property enjoys a lovely setting on the eastern slopes of the Malvern Hills. It lies within a conservation area approximately two miles south of the historic cultural spa town of Great Malvern where there is a comprehensive range of amenities including shops and banks, Waitrose supermarket, the renowned theatre and cinema complex, the Splash leisure centre and Manor Park Sports Club.



The town has a deserved reputation for the quality and choice of its educational facilities. There are a number of highly regarded schools in both the state and private sectors at primary and secondary levels including the renowned Malvern College and Malvern St James Girls' School.



Transport communications are excellent. There is a mainline railway station in the centre of the town. Junction 7 of the M5 motorway at Worcester is about ten miles away and Junction 1 of the M50 south of Upton upon Severn is a similar distance. The larger cities of Worcester (ten miles), Hereford (twenty miles), Cheltenham and Gloucester (twenty five miles) are within commuting distance.



For those who enjoy the outdoor life Worcestershire Golf Club is less than half a mile away and the network of paths and bridleways that criss-cross the Malvern Hills are within walking distance. The Three Counties Showground is also only a few minutes away on foot and the banks of the River Severn which runs through the nearby historic town of Upton are easily accessible.
